Read MoreKatie Ledecky passes Michael Phelps for most individual golds at world championships
The 26-year-old American won the 800-meter freestyle on Saturday at the world championships to become the first swimmer to win six golds in the same event at worlds. (Image credit: Lee Jin-man/AP)

Read MoreBlinken says Niger must restore ‘democratic order’ to avoid loss of U.S. economic aid
Political instability in Niger resulting from a military takeover that deposed the president this week threatens the economic support provided by Washington to the African nation, U.S. Secretary of State Anthony Blinken said Saturday.
